« Reply #49 on: September 18, 2007, 08:49:04 AM »
hh6 and effin check out these offensive stats so far. Vs a 10 - 6 jets team and a 14 -2 chargers team.



Tom Brady: 546 yards passing, 6 TD's, 1 Int. Completing 80% of his passes with a QB rating of 134.
Randy Moss: 17 rec, 288 yards, 3 TD's averaging 16.9 YPC
Wes Welker: 14 rec, 152 yards, 1 TD, avg 10.9 YPC
Laurence Maroney: 35 atts, 149 yards rushing, avg 4.3 YPC
Sammy Morris: 21 atts, 105 yards, avg 5 YPC, 1 TD
Ben Watson: 7 rec, 58 yards, avg 8.3 YPC, 2 TD's
Donte Stallworth: 3 rec, 38 yards, avg 12.7 YPC
